Reinforcement Learning from Human Feedback (RLHF) - a simplified explanation

Maybe you've heard about this technique but you haven't completely understood it, especially the PPO part. This explanation might help.

We will focus on text-to-text language models 📝, such as GPT-3, BLOOM, and T5. Models like BERT, which are encoder-only, are not addressed.

Reinforcement Learning from Human Feedback (RLHF) has been successfully applied in ChatGPT, hence its major increase in popularity. 📈

RLHF is especially useful in two scenarios 🌟:

  • You can’t create a good loss function
    • Example: how do you calculate a metric to measure if the model’s output was funny?
  • You want to train with production data, but you can’t easily label your production data

Cheat sheet for common cats monad and fs2 operation shapes
Operation Input Result Notes
map F[A] , A => B F[B] Functor
apply F[A] , F[A => B] F[B] Applicative
(fa, fb, ...).mapN (F[A], F[B], ...) , (A, B, ...) => C F[C] Applicative
(fa, fb, ...).tupled (F[A], F[B], ...) F[(A, B, ...)] Applicative
flatMap F[A] , A => F[B] F[B] Monad
traverse F[A] , A => G[B] G[F[A]] Traversable; fa.traverse(f) == fa.map(f).sequence; "foreach with effects"
sequence F[G[A]] G[F[A]] Same as fga.traverse(identity)
attempt F[A] F[Either[E, A]] Given ApplicativeError[F, E]

install nvm on mac with zsh shell
After install zsh
- brew update
- brew install nvm
- mkdir ~/.nvm
after in your ~/.zshrc or in .bash_profile if your use bash shell:
export NVM_DIR=~/.nvm
source $(brew --prefix nvm)/nvm.sh

1. Mastering Functions

A function is a mapping from one set, called a domain, to another set, called the codomain. A function associates every element in the domain with exactly one element in the codomain. In Scala, both domain and codomain are types.

val square : Int => Int = x => x * x
